Impact
The implementation of the following functions were determined to include a use-after-free bug:
FetchEvent.client.tlsCipherOpensslNameFetchEvent.client.tlsProtocolFetchEvent.client.tlsClientCertificateFetchEvent.client.tlsJA3MD5FetchEvent.client.tlsClientHelloCacheEntry.prototype.userMetadataof thefastly:cachesubsystemDevice.lookupof thefastly:devicesubsystem
This bug could allow for an unintended data leak if the result of the preceding functions were sent anywhere else, and often results in a Compute service crash causing an HTTP 500 error to be returned. As all requests to Compute are isolated from one another, the only data at risk is data present for a single request.
Patches
This bug has been fixed in version 3.16.0 of the @fastly/js-compute package.
Workarounds
There are no workarounds for this bug, any use of the affected functions introduces the possibility of a data leak or crash in guest code.
The vulnerability can be exploited over the network without needing physical access. It is difficult for an attacker to exploit this vulnerability and may require special conditions. An attacker needs high-level or administrative privileges. The attacker needs the user to perform some action, like clicking a link. The impact is confined to the system where the vulnerability exists. There is a low impact on the confidentiality of the information. There is a low impact on the integrity of the data. There is a high impact on the availability of the system.
